GSP Helps Auntie Anne’s Manage Menu Changes

Pretzel maker using retail services provider's Print On Demand technology

CLEARWATER, Fla. -- GSP, a leading provider of services for convenience-store, foodservice and other retailers, is helping soft-pretzel franchise Auntie Anne’s market its snacks with new Print On Demand technology. The software gives more than 900 Auntie Anne’s locations the freedom to print their own location-specific menu boards in a custom, online template created to uphold corporate brand standards.

GSP created its exclusive Print On Demand technology to meet the needs of multi-unit consumer-facing brands in a fast-paced marketplace. The cloud-based platform makes it accessible from anywhere, with no special programming or design skills necessary.

“We needed a more convenient solution for ordering menu boards to help us stay competitive,” said Meredith Wenz, director of marketing for Auntie Anne’s. “The existing process did not allow for all of the product variations and the numerous franchise requests that could overload our marketing and creative teams.”

“We are happy that we were able to customize Print On Demand software so all menu board requests are processed and built through a single system,” said Kevin Farley, GSP’s COO. “The system makes it easy for users to select products sold at their location. It even knows how to space the product text correctly and maximize images. It gives Auntie Anne’s the flexibility to adjust pricing for local variations and test new items without compromising brand consistency.”

At its more than 1,600 locations around the world, Auntie Anne’s mixes, twists and bakes pretzels from scratch all day in full view of customers. Auntie Anne’s can be found in malls, outlet centers and Wal-Mart stores, as well as in nontraditional spaces such as universities, airports, travel plazas, amusement parks and military bases. In addition, it has extended the brand onto retailers’ shelves and also serves as a distributor for fundraising products. Available at select retailers nationwide, pretzel fans can enjoy Auntie Anne’s prepare-at-home products, from frozen Classic and Cinnamon Sugar Soft Pretzels and Pretzel Nuggets, to frozen Pretzel Dogs and Pretzel Pocket Sandwiches, to a Pretzel Baking Kit.

Atlanta-based Focus Brands Inc., through its affiliate brands, is the franchisor and operator of more than 5,000 ice-cream shops, bakeries, restaurants and cafés in the United States and globally under the brand names Carvel, Cinnabon, Schlotzsky’s, Moe’s Southwest Grill, Auntie Anne’s and McAlister’s Deli, as well as Seattle’s Best Coffee on certain military bases and in certain international markets.

GSP is a retail services provider based in Clearwater, Fla. By using surveys and a proprietary software system, GSP helps retailers accurately measure and store site data, guaranteeing the right size sign is delivered to the right store every time with no overage. GSP also offers marketing, food photography, industrial design, visual merchandising, graphics and smart point-of-purchase (POP) program management to more than 60,000 retail locations throughout North America. Recent growth led GSP to add AccuStore, a survey, app and site profiling software brand, and the large-format graphics lab Great Big Pictures, which specializes in fashion retail.
